Fixing human rights protection in health and social care It’s been a while… sorry! The Mental Health Bill 2024 is now before Parliament, its second reading is on Monday 25th November, and Parliamentarians will be able to discuss it and table …

A recent court ruling has left gaps in human rights protection for adults and children in health and social care settings. Here's how Parliament could fix it thesmallplaces.wordpress.com/2024/11/22/f... c

Between epistemic injustice and therapeutic jurisprudence: Coronial processes involving families of autistic people, people with learning disabilities and/or mental ill health Understanding how and why someone dies unexpectedly is key to bereaved family members. The coronial process in England investigates instances where the cause of death is unknown, violent or unnatural...
